DENVER (CBS) – Winter is coming, and for some people that means seasonal affective disorder.

Some people call them the winter blues, and they can be tough. Brook Brown from Camp Bow Wow stopped by CBS4 studios to talk about the mental health benefits that come along with owning a pet.
